How do you list credentials on a resume?

You can list credentials, like doctorates and specialized degrees, right after your name at the top of a resume. You can list all other credentials, such as important strengths and skills, later in your resume where they fit most naturally.

What are your qualifications and credentials?

“Credentials” often refer to academic or educational qualifications, such as degrees or diplomas that you have completed or partially-completed. “Credentials” can also refer to occupational qualifications, such as professional certificates or work experience.

What are examples of credentials?

Examples of credentials include academic diplomas, academic degrees, certifications, security clearances, identification documents, badges, passwords, user names, keys, powers of attorney, and so on.

How do I write credentials after my name?

Either way is correct when writing out your name and credentials — Jane Doe, RN, BSN, or Jane Doe, BSN, RN. In the world of academia, the college degree is used first and then licensure and other credentials.

What are credentials on a phone?

A mobile credential is a digital access credential that sits on an Apple® iOS or Android™-based smart device. Mobile credentials work exactly the same way as a traditional physical credential, but don’t require the user to interact with their credential to gain access to a controlled area.
